Euromonitor?s data on tobacco in Brazil point to sales posting a positive trajectory over the last few years. The positive prospects for this industry may also be seen as a positive factor driving sales of NRT smoking cessation aids in the country, as the latter category depends on smokers to continue selling its products. On average, smoking prevalence among the adult Brazilian population is 12% in 2018, resulting in more than 18 million people smoking.
